Getting Your Home Ready for Market in Bedford VA


The town of Bedford in Virginia is well known for all the history that can be found on almost every corner. But one place where history may not be quite as celebrated is in the clutter that has accumulated over the winter months. Even though there are plenty of thing to keep you busy during any season; the piles of novels, Sudoku puzzles and extra blankets are a history of how you spent your time while indoors. If you are thinking of putting your house on the market, or if you are just getting a jump start on spring cleaning, here are a few tips to get your home “show ready”.
If you ask a real estate agent what the number one suggestion is to clients they will tell you: “Get rid of the clutter”. This doesn’t mean that everything needs to end up on the curb. It is a great time to give away the things you really don’t have space for any more. Your local Goodwill , Salvation Army, or other local charities can get the things you don’t need into the hands of those that do. Some even offer pick up services and can be used as a tax donation.
Ok, the truck just drove off with your charitable donation; now let’s clean and organize! As you are organizing and storing your prized possessions, you should take the time to dust and clean those nooks and crannies that have collected dust over the winter. Don’t forget to dust the objects on the shelves too! Those attentions to details mean a lot to potential buyers.
For storage, you can’t beat buying a few inexpensive baskets! The ones with lids are even better. You can hide your magazines and extra blankets inside while adding texture and visual interest in the room. If you read a lot, you can turn those hard-backed books into pedestals by stacking them and placing a plant or pottery on top. This can add a decorative touch to the room without having to put your favorite reads into storage.
Whether you are readying your home for sell or just getting your home organized, taking the time to get deal with clutter now means more time spent outdoors come spring!
